Foot and leg swelling is actually a very common problem, usually due to an accumulation of fluid in the lower extremity. It may be exacerbated by standing for an extended period of time. However it could also result from being seated for a long time, such as while on a long flight. Fluid retention can also result from high sodium diets, pregnancy or while women have their menstrual periods.
Fluid retention may also be a sign of a more serious problem such as heart, liver or kidney failure. Your boyfriend needs to be evaluated by a medical doctor in order to determine the cause of the problem.
